Recently, a seemingly far-fetched story of a gamer facing account lockout has caught the community by surprise. Specifically, a gamer from Trùng Khánh (China) with a locked QQ account made the journey from Trùng Khánh to Tencent headquarters in Shenzhen (over 1,400 km) on the second day of Lunar New Year to demand its unlocking.

'I've been using this QQ account since elementary school; it's incredibly important to me!' – Shared the gamer. Despite reaching out to customer service, the account remained blocked. Eventually, driven by anger, the gamer threatened during a chat with Tencent's customer support team that he would come in person to... 'make some noise'.
Finally, the efforts of this gamer were rewarded when he stepped out of Tencent's customer reception center in Shenzhen and posted 'Long time no see' on his account. After over half a year, the gamer's account was unblocked.

Despite the hefty price tag of this 'pilgrimage,' amounting to 1,200 Chinese Yuan (over 4 million Vietnamese Dong), the gamer asserted that the journey was well worth it, even on the first day of the new year. 'I'll be more cautious to ensure my account isn't locked again; I don't want to go through this journey again,' the gamer shared.
The online community has been full of praise for this courageous and determined gamer, albeit with a hint of 'naivety,' but ultimately, everything turned out successful. The gamer also made it clear: 'This is a personal action; please do not follow suit.'
